Expanding the Silent Universe: Beyond the Farm

The original A Quiet Place skillfully confined its narrative to the Abbott family and their desperate struggle for survival on their secluded farm. The A Quiet Place Part II trailer shatters this isolation, thrusting Evelyn (Emily Blunt), Regan (Millicent Simmonds), and Marcus (Noah Jupe) into a larger, more perilous world. This expansion is crucial for the franchise’s longevity; repeating the same formula would quickly become stale. The trailer strategically reveals snippets of this broadened scope: a bustling railway yard, encounters with other survivors, and hints of larger settlements struggling to cope with the alien invasion.

The trailer expertly builds tension by contrasting the quiet, methodical survival strategies of the first film with the chaotic desperation of this new reality. We see moments of intense silence, punctuated by bursts of intense action, mirroring the precarious balance the Abbotts must maintain. Cillian Murphy’s character, Emmett, represents this new element perfectly. He’s hardened, cynical, and initially reluctant to help, embodying the inherent distrust bred by the apocalyptic situation. He’s not just another survivor; he’s a reflection of the world’s descent into a brutal, Darwinian struggle.

Regan’s Growing Independence and Deafness as a Strength

Regan Abbott, brilliantly portrayed by Millicent Simmonds (who is herself deaf), takes on a more prominent role in A Quiet Place Part II. Her deafness, initially a vulnerability, is now explicitly highlighted as a strength. The trailer showcases her ability to detect subtle vibrations and her understanding of the monsters’ reliance on sound. This evolution transforms her from a dependent child to a key player in the fight for survival. She is no longer just surviving; she’s adapting and using her unique abilities to protect her family and potentially find a weakness in the monsters.

Decoding the Silent Threat: New Vulnerabilities and Hope

The trailer doesn’t simply rehash the known dangers; it actively introduces new layers to the monsters’ capabilities and, more importantly, their vulnerabilities. We see glimpses of environments that seem to weaken them, suggesting that certain frequencies or atmospheric conditions may offer a respite from the relentless threat. The railway yard scene, in particular, hints at the potential for using noise against them, a reversal of the Abbotts’ previous strategy of absolute silence.

The presence of the hearing aid, which was instrumental in discovering the monsters’ vulnerability in the first film, remains a crucial element. The trailer suggests that Regan is actively seeking to understand the monsters’ auditory weaknesses, potentially using the modified hearing aid as a weapon or a detection device. This proactive approach is a significant departure from the reactive survival tactics of the first film, indicating a more offensive strategy.
